“Shuijing” Pears from Cangqiao Approved to Be “Recommended Fruit for Olympics
 

“Shuijing” pears from Cangqiao stood out in the competition for the selection of “Recommended Fruit for Olympics 2008” and was approved to “enter Beijing” as a recommended fruit for the Beijing Olympics in August. By then, the pear will make its debut in Beijing.

It is learned that only Cangqiao “Shuijing” pears and Malu grapes in Shanghai won the honorable certificate of “Recommended Fruit for Olympics 2008” jointly issued by the China National Forestry Industry Association, China Fruit Circulation Association, Chinese Society for Horticultural Science, and Beijing Fruit Industry Association.
